Softball Preview: Northwood Chargers vs. Jordan-Matthews Jets
The Northwood Chargers will venture away from home to face off against the Jordan-Matthews Jets at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Northwood has now lost nine straight dating back to last season, leaving the team hunting for their first win since April 16.
Northwood came up short against Pinecrest on Monday, falling 22-7.
Makenna Lux was cooking despite her team's loss, going 2-for-3 with three RBI and one stolen base. Makenzie Robinson was another key player, scoring a run and stealing Two bases. while going 1-for-2.
Meanwhile, Jordan-Matthews gave their fans exactly what they wanted out of a home opener on Tuesday. Everything went their way against Lee County as Jordan-Matthews made off with an 18-5 win. The victory continues a trend for the Jets in their matchups with the Yellow Jackets: they've now won three in a row.
Northwood's loss d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Jordan-Matthews, their win was their 11th stra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 1-0.
Northwood might still be hurting after the 10-0 defeat they got from Jordan-Matthews in their previous matchup back in April of 2024. Can Northwood av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
